TCU unveils alternate uniforms for opener against LSU

TCU head coach Gary Patterson accidentally left LSU fans seeing red earlier this summer, but the Horned Frogs hope to do it on purpose next Saturday by wearing new all-black alternate uniforms with red accents for their season opener against the Tigers at AT&T Stadium.

The new look, unveiled Friday afternoon, features one red stripe on each side of the helmet, red striping on the palms of gloves, and red highlights on the cleats, inspired by the horned frog's ability to spit blood from its eyes as a defense mechanism.

The football Horned Frogs will be without one of their top defensive mechanisms for the game, as Freshman All-America defensive end Devonte Fields begins serving a two-game suspension for violating team rules.
